Export csv -problème affichage-

Répondre


Cette question est un moyen d’empêcher des soumissions automatisées de formulaires par des robots.
Smileys
:D :) :( :o :shock: :? 8-) :lol: :x :P :oops: :cry: :evil: :twisted: :roll: :wink: :!: :?: :idea: :arrow: :| :mrgreen: =D> #-o =P~ :^o :non: :priere: 8-|
Voir plus de smileys
  Revue du sujet
 

  Étendre la vue Revue du sujet : Export csv -problème affichage-

Re: Export csv -problème affichage-

par JeanB » 29 avr. 2011, 11:33

Résolu, le fichier était en lecture seule car il était seulement ouvert et non téléchargé

Re: Export csv -problème affichage-

par JeanB » 29 avr. 2011, 11:25

Merci, les accents sont maintenant bien reconnus.

Pour ce qui est de ma deuxième question, une idée?:
Lorsque ce fichier se télécharge il est en lecture seule, comment peut-on donner les pleins accès aux fichier?

Re: Export csv -problème affichage-

par nhachet » 29 avr. 2011, 11:08

Avant d'envoyer tes données dans ton fichier "testExport.csv", il faut les décoder avec un UTF8_decode.
Excel gère mal l'UTF8.

Export csv -problème affichage-

par JeanB » 29 avr. 2011, 11:05

Bonjour,

lorsque j'applique ce code pour me sortir un .csv

Code : Tout sélectionner

<?php header("Content-Type: application/octet-stream; charset=iso-8859-1"); header("Content-Type: application/csv-tab-delimited-table"); header('Content-Disposition: attachment; filename="testExport.csv"'); readfile("testExport.csv"); ?>
J'obtiens en résultat que ce soit sous Calc(OpenOffice) ou Excel: Début texte n°1 etc..

J'ai également testé: header("Content-Type: application/octet-stream; charset=utf-8");
mais toujours le même problème, les accents sont mals gérés.

Vous voyez d'où viens de problème?

De plus, lorsque ce fichier se télécharge il est en lecture seule, comment peut-on donner les pleins accès aux fichier?